Pursuant to the provisions of the Law Amending the Law on Census of Population, Households and Dwellings in the Republic of Macedonia 2011, the pre-enumeration of the persons who are held in custody or are serving a sentence in a correctional facility or a reformatory will be conducted in the period from 1 to 15 September.
For that purpose, on 25. 08. 2011, the State Statistical Office organised, again, a training in conducting pre-enumeration that will be realised in cooperation with the Ministry of Justice.
The training objectives were presented, the significance, the legal bases, the basic principles and characteristics of the Census, as well as the manner of completing the Form P-1 (enumeration form).
Violeta Krsteva, Head of the Social Statistics Sector, in the introduction addressed the significance of the forthcoming Census and its methodological bases. The questions related to the units (persons) that will be covered by the pre-enumeration were specially presented, and they relate to the persons who during the Census are held in custody or are serving a sentence in a correctional facility or a reformatory.
The manner of completing the Form P-1 (Enumeration form) was presented by Jane Krstevski, Adviser in the Department for Demography and Statistical Register of Population and Violeta Deleva, Junior Associate in the Department for Demography and Statistical Register of Population.
The training was attended by 10 representatives of the Ministry of Justice, the correctional facilities and the reformatories. The participants followed the training actively and practical questions were also discussed.
